1. Proactive Prevention of Repetitive Strain Injuries (RSI)
The primary, undeniable medical benefit of using a deeply sculpted mouse is the proactive defense against severe physical wrist injuries. When you hold a traditional, flat ambidextrous mouse, you are forced to pronate your forearm (twisting it completely flat against the hard surface of your desk). Holding this unnaturally twisted posture for 8 to 12 hours a day severely compresses the median nerve passing through your wrist, causing tingling, numbness, and agonizing pain.
Premium Ergonomic Gaming Mice feature a distinct, tilted, asymmetrical chassis. By raising the left side of the mouse (for right-handed users), the design gently rotates your hand into a much more natural, semi-vertical “handshake” posture. This slight 15 to 25-degree vertical tilt completely opens up the carpal tunnel, drastically reducing the physical compression on your highly sensitive nerves. 2. Dedicated Thumb Rests and Pinky Support
One of the most frustrating and accuracy-destroying aspects of using a generic mouse is “finger drag.” As you make rapid, sweeping tracking movements across your fabric mousepad, your thumb or pinky finger often drags against the mat, creating highly inconsistent physical friction that completely ruins your aiming muscle memory.
High-end ergonomic models feature heavily sculpted side grips and dedicated, flaired thumb rests (often resembling a subtle horizontal wing). This structural shelf allows your thumb to rest completely relaxed on the chassis, ensuring that only the ultra-smooth PTFE skates of the mouse ever make contact with the pad. This brilliant structural support ensures your glide remains perfectly consistent, eliminating unpredictable micro-friction during critical sniper shots.
3. Optimizing the Palm Grip for Absolute Stability
Not everyone holds a mouse the exact same way. However, ergonomic silhouettes are specifically tailored to maximize the comfort of the most common and stable grip style in the gaming world: the Palm Grip. Because the back hump of an ergonomic mouse is taller and slopes gently toward the right side, it fills the empty biological cavity of your palm completely.
This full-contact, edge-to-edge support means you do not have to aggressively tense your fingers to maintain physical control of the device. The mouse essentially becomes a deeply organic extension of your arm, allowing for fluid, sweeping movements utilizing your elbow rather than isolating the stress onto your fragile wrist joint.

5. Managing Physical Weight for Rapid Sweeps
If an ergonomic mouse is built like a massive 150-gram brick, the heavy kinetic friction on your wrist completely negates the brilliant benefits of the sculpted shape. Hardware manufacturers have aggressively addressed this issue by applying ultra-lightweight aerospace engineering techniques to ergonomic shells.
By utilizing internal honeycomb ribbing and advanced, thin-wall injection molding, many premium ergonomic mice now weigh well under 65 grams. Can left-handed gamers use standard ergonomic mice?
Unfortunately, standard ergonomic mice are highly asymmetrical and strictly designed for right-handed users. A left-handed person attempting to hold a right-handed ergonomic mouse will find the curvature completely backward and unusable. However, premium hardware brands do manufacture specialized, mirrored “Left-Handed Editions” of their most popular ergonomic models to accommodate the left-handed gaming community perfectly.
How long does it take to get used to an ergonomic mouse shape?
If you have used a flat, symmetrical mouse for the past 10 years, transitioning to a highly tilted ergonomic mouse will require a brief adjustment period. Your muscle memory typically adapts within 3 to 7 days of consistent use. After this short adjustment phase, the vast majority of users report that returning to a flat mouse feels incredibly uncomfortable and unnatural.
